CI note: spoolerd pipeline flaking on Korvex runners. The printer-spooler microservice fails its healthcheck during the container warmup stage — port binds late when the queue replay is large. Not a code regression. Workaround: retry the stage once; if it fails twice, purge the replay volume before rerunning. Do not restart the whole pipeline; that resets the artifact cache and doubles build time. Fix lands next sprint in spoolerd's init ordering. For escalations, reference the failing build token below.

trace token, fafog-kageg: htk4_98e6

Action item from the Lanternfish outage review: partition the ticket_events table by month before the next quarterly load spike. Support should expect brief read-only windows during the migration, tentatively scheduled over two weekends. Queries against historical tickets may be slower until indexes are rebuilt. Ariela's team will post migration status updates as each partition is backfilled. Progress and rollback notes are tracked on the internal page here.

wiki page, bagaf-fawip: https://harbor.tolvaqsys.local/pages/repo/pages/secrets/eac969ffc71f356b

Short version: the Hummingbird fan-out layer applies backpressure when your plugin pushes faster than downstream channels can drain. You'll see `429 SLOW_DOWN` responses with a `retry-after` hint — honor it, don't hammer. Batching up to 500 recipients per call is almost always the fix; per-recipient calls are what trips the limiter. If you genuinely need a higher quota, there's a request process, and yes, we actually grant them. Rate tiers, batching examples, and the quota request form are all documented here.

runbook for badug-kadup: https://confluence.zemvarlabs.internal/projects/browse/display/projects/bd1b